Job Description:
Job Description: This job is responsible for supporting the
Market Executive in driving out business strategy, directly
managing financial advisors and yielding responsible growth through
operational excellence and risk management. Key responsibilities
include recruiting, retaining and developing talent, creating a
strong sales and service culture, and coordinating across teams to
deliver a seamless client and advisor experience. Job expectations
include building collaborative relationships across the market and
externally to grow market share. Responsibilities: •Executes
components of the market business plan with a focus on advisor
productivity, revenue growth. •Supports all aspects of talent
development, engagement and retention to create a culture of
opportunity, inclusion, and respect in a highly matrixed
environment. •Coaches Advisors to consistently deliver an
exceptional client experience by providing guidance, feedback, and
support that reinforces a client-first culture. •Supports
cross-functional collaboration by coordinating with Office
Management Team and other internal partners to deliver integrated
client solutions. •Promotes adherence to risk and compliance
standards, supporting the ME in maintaining a strong control
environment and appropriately engaging to escalate and/or remediate
when needed. •Supports Market Executive as the regulatory
supervisor of an office and/or group of financial advisors, working
in partnership with Supervision and Control partners to oversee
activities that require advanced licensing. •Represents the firm in
local market (LMO) activities, business development efforts,
advisor recruiting and community events to support market growth.
Skills: Business Acumen Coaching Decision Making Executive Presence
Recruiting Customer and Client focus Inclusive Leadership
Relationship Building Risk Management Emotional Intelligence
Leadership Development Performance Management Process Effectiveness
Conflict Management Drives Engagement Required Qualifications:
•Minimum 8 years professional experience . Desired Qualifications:
•Series 7, Series 63 and 65 or 66, Series 9 and Series 10, and
Series 31 or 3 is strongly preferred. Must be able to obtain within
120 days. •3 years direct or matrixed management experience
preferred. •Strong leadership and communication skills with
executive presence that garners attention and impact. •Proven
ability to lead people to perform through a poised, confident
demeanor that commands respect and action. •Agile learner with
demonstrated resilience and ability to lead self and others through
change. •Experience influencing at scale, including associates
outside of direct reporting line . •Strong judgment and decision
making, particularly on issues relating to risk management, talent,
performance management, and problem resolution. •Proven ability to
manage multiple and sometimes competing priorities. •Experience in
unpredictable environments, including unplanned internal or
external needs. •Wealth management acumen, inclusive of product
knowledge, regulatory and supervisory requirements, industry trends
and firm-wide initiatives. •Bachelor’s degree or equivalent work
experience preferred. Shift: 1st shift (United States of America)
